Who We Are
Mission: To support our community through education, bridging the economic gap for the low income community, which is disproportionately made up of minorities.
For more than 175 years, St. Vincent and Sarah Fisher Center has provided support to the children and families of Southeastern Michigan. We provide educational programs, basic skill building and learning enhancement for at-risk children and adults, designed to build self-sufficiency skills for academic and employment success, personal achievement and dignity.
What We Do
St. Vincent and Sarah Fisher (SVSF) Center provides educational programs, basic skill building and learning enhancement for at-risk children and adults, designed to build self-sufficiency skills for academic and employment success, personal achievement and dignity. Volunteering with SVSF includes getting involved with the community. The primary focus for our volunteers is to tutor students. Our volunteers also help staff with administrative functions and other operational focuses.
